Remember the RENE price doesn't include the box which is worth quite a bit by itself and that the price is for a 95 percent gun. A near mint one goes up from there
 
RENE list the Old Model .45 Blackhawk, 7 1/2 in bl. in 95% condition at $775.00. The same gun as a convertible is at $845.00. A box for the above guns would be listed at $150.00. The manual at $32.00.

Those prices are what a collector buying from another collector both knowing what they are buying or selling, would consider in the ball park value. Yes it's possible to find someone needing to sell and not knowing what they have, and get it for a cheaper price. One needs to remember, though, there are less Old Model .45 Blackhawks made then .44 Mag. Flattops and you know what they sell for. So if this is a nice gun don't let it get away.
